## Description:
- Apache Phoenix enables SQL-based OLTP and operational analytics
for Apache Hadoop
## Issues:
- There are no issues requiring board attention at this time
## Activity:
- 4.14.0 release (rc0) being voted upon now
- 5.0.0-alpha release completed mid-February
- 5.0.0 release (rc0) incoming soon
- Completed IP Clearance process to adopt a new codebase: a Python-based
driver originally developed outside of Apache.
- PhoenixCon is scheduled for June 18th in San Jose, California, USA.
The event will be held concurrently with HBaseCon (same day, same
space).
A subset of PMC members are presently finalizing talks which will
be given at the event. https://phoenix.apache.org/phoenixcon-2018/
## Health report:
- Overall the project is maintaining its healthy state. We have
our strong core developers, a regular collection of users getting
involved, new developers submitting fixes, and releases happening.
PMC needs to evaluate contributors and committers for new committers
and PMC members, respectively.
## PMC changes:
- Currently 25 PMC members.
- No new PMC members added in the last 3 months
- Last PMC addition was Sergey Soldatov on Mon Oct 02 2017
## Committer base changes:
- Currently 35 committers.
- No new committers added in the last 3 months
- Last committer addition was Pedro Boado at Tue Jan 30 2018
## Releases:
- 5.0.0-alpha was released on Tue Feb 13 2018
## Mailing list activity:
- Both dev and user lists are trending upward slightly over
the previous quarter but are not significantly different.
## JIRA activity:
- 144 JIRA tickets created in the last 3 months
- 135 JIRA tickets closed/resolved in the last 3 months
